Anička s lískovými oříšky

A romantic fairy tale about faithful love and how difficult it is to fulfill it. "I have never seen two sisters who love each other so much," sighs King Stephen when he discovers his one true love, the orphaned knight's daughter Anička, in an old fortress in the woods where he wanders while hunting. And indeed, Katka stands faithfully by her stepsister's side, even though fate, thanks to her stepmother's curse, prepares the most difficult trials that a young, beautiful girl can encounter. And so, in the final song, the fairy queen can sing not only to the lovers from the fairy tale, but also to all of us: "Every love overcomes evil, every love interprets God, the flower that stands alone withers, so I have love for you..."
